The Reaction is a website for entertainment and inspiration with chemistry, run by the RSC.
Its News section has articles, written in plain English, about chemistry in the news; the fascinating role of chemicals in history and columns from guest writers including British astronaut and chemist Helen Sharman.
The Explore Chemistry section includes our favourite chemistry videos from around the net, from explosions to and some jargon-free explanations of why chemistry is vital to our future food, water and energy supplies.
You'll also find:
- live webcasts
- on-demand videos
- photos and other information about the public events we host in the Chemistry Centre in London
Previous events have been about topics such as the chemical secrets of art restoration, the history of curry, and the complex artistry of perfume creation.
